GraČani - spacious house with yard, 356 m2
Order Real Estate mediates the sale of a house in Gračane.
The property consists of a basement, ground floor and two floors.
On the ground floor there is a living room, kitchen, bedroom, bathroom.
On the first floor there is a kitchen, three bedrooms, toilet.
On the second floor there is a living room, kitchen, two bedrooms, bathroom.
Additional characteristics of the house:
- gas central heating
- air conditioning on 2.
floor
Year of construction: 1963.
- last adaptation: 2019.
(changed ground floor installations)
- roof replaced in 2010.
years - wooden roofing, insulation and tile
- PVC carpentry set 2012.
years.
The house is for sale furnished.
On the landscaped garden there is a facility that includes a kitchen, toilet and storage.
The house has two garages.
All documentation is clean, possible purchase by credit.

Zagreb is the capital and largest city of Croatia. It is in the north of the country, along the Sava River, at the southern slopes of the Medvednica mountain. Zagreb stands near the international border between Croatia and Slovenia at an elevation of approximately 158 m (518 ft) above sea level. At the 2021 census, the city itself had a population of 767,131, while the population of the Zagreb metropolitan area is 1,086,528.
